matlab 从csv提取数据变成数组

2024-11-16 11:52:01
推荐回答(1个)
回答(1):

读csv文件可用的函数有csvread(其本质是调用了dlmread)。但这个函数对于指定列范围而不指定行范围调用起来可能会有点问题,可以考虑的做法是全部读进来,然后再提取前两列。另外,还可以用xlsread函数读csv文件。

 

这些函数的读文件能力在不同版本可能有差别,而CSV格式的定义也不够统一,有时会出现一些不好预见的问题。题主可以参考一下相关的几个函数的帮助,自己试一下,如果有问题,请把csv文件上传至网盘,我再帮题主分析(请说明所用MATLAB版本)。